Patiently Observing Black Bears: Black bears are elusive and mysterious creatures, often found roaming through dense forests. To capture compelling shots of these powerful animals, I spent countless hours patiently observing their behavior from a safe distance. By immersing myself in their environment, I gained a deeper understanding of their habits and movements. This allowed me to anticipate their actions, enabling me to capture intimate moments, from playful cubs exploring their surroundings to the majestic bears foraging for food.

Navigating the Realm of Grizzlies: Encountering grizzly bears in their natural habitat is an awe-inspiring experience that demands respect and caution. The key to capturing extraordinary shots of these formidable giants lies in meticulous planning and careful positioning. I invested time in researching their preferred locations and feeding grounds, which helped me identify ideal spots for observation. With a telephoto lens as my trusted ally, I maintained a safe distance while capturing stunning close-ups, emphasizing the intricate details of their powerful builds and striking features.

Scaling Heights with Mountain Goats: The rugged landscapes inhabited by mountain goats present a unique challenge for photographers. These sure-footed creatures traverse steep cliffs and precipitous terrain with seemingly effortless grace. To capture their remarkable agility and resilience, I ventured to higher altitudes, often enduring challenging conditions and strenuous hikes. This allowed me to position myself at eye level with the mountain goats, enabling me to capture extraordinary shots that highlight their thick white coats, impressive horns, and the breathtaking vistas that serve as their playground.

Mastering Light and Composition: In wildlife photography, understanding and utilizing natural light is crucial. The interplay between light and shadow adds depth and dimension to photographs, enhancing the overall visual impact. I paid careful attention to the time of day and weather conditions, aiming to capture the animals in the soft glow of sunrise or the warm hues of sunset. Additionally, I employed various compositional techniques, such as leading lines and the rule of thirds, to create visually engaging and impactful images.
